Roof Construction in Framingham, MA
Roof construction services encompass the design and installation of new roofing systems on residential properties. This includes a range of projects such as building roofs for new homes, replacing existing roofs that have reached the end of their lifespan, and installing roofing on additions or renovations. Property owners typically want to understand the different materials available, the structural considerations involved, and how the new roof will complement the overall appearance of the home.
Before requesting roof construction services, homeowners often seek guidance on the scope of work needed, the types of roofing materials suitable for their property,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s important to consider factors like weather resistance, durability, and energy efficiency when planning a new roof. Clear communication about project expectations and understanding the process can help ensure the final result meets the property owner’s needs.

Common Roof Construction Jobs
Roof Replacement - involves installing a new roof to replace an aging or damaged one.
Roof Repair - addresses leaks, damaged shingles, or other issues to restore roof integrity.
Storm Damage Repair - fixes damage caused by hail, wind, or falling debris after severe weather.
Roof Inspections - assess the condition of a roof to identify potential problems early.
Roof Ventilation - improves airflow to help regulate temperature and prolong roof lifespan.
New Roof Installation - provides a durable, weather-resistant roof for new construction projects.
Roof Construction Questions
What types of roofs are suitable for construction projects?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and wood shakes, depending on the property's style and needs.
How is a new roof installed on an existing structure? The process involves removing the old roofing material, inspecting the underlying structure, and then installing the new roofing system securely.
What should property owners consider before starting a roof construction project? It's important to assess the roof's condition, select appropriate materials, and ensure proper ventilation and insulation.
Are roof construction services available for new builds or only replacements? These services typically cover both new construction projects and roof replacements for existing buildings.
